Jools Wills
07a35d94a0
inputconfig - move sdl1_map to parent script / cleanup
2016-08-08 16:10:42 +01:00
Jools Wills
861f2f1bff
Merge pull request #1616 from superjamie/inputconfig-pisnes
...
pisnes - add input configuration script
2016-08-08 15:58:21 +01:00
Jamie Bainbridge
1a758b7403
pisnes - add input configuration script
...
Move SDL keyboard mapping to its own function to be called by all
emulators, and create a config script for pisnes based off pifba
Tested with Logitech F710 (xpad) and iBuffalo SNES (usbhid)
Resolves https://github.com/RetroPie/RetroPie-Setup/issues/1609
Signed-off-by: Jamie Bainbridge <jamie.bainbridge@gmail.com>
2016-08-08 22:00:23 +10:00
gizmo98
0e8db04f08
mupen64plus: add expansion pak switching
...
leftthumb = mempak
rightthumb = rumblepak
2016-08-07 12:43:11 +02:00
RetroPieNerd
64f2a09d5d
Update esthemes.sh
2016-08-06 11:41:44 -07:00
Jools Wills
4a530f9cbb
scraper - config ownership
2016-08-06 18:25:58 +01:00
Jools Wills
fbbfe9b992
scraper - fix max_width not saving. move module config loading to helpers
2016-08-06 18:17:51 +01:00
Jools Wills
3f2c909b78
configedit - added pulse as option for audio_driver - fixes #1601
2016-08-05 17:56:06 +01:00
Jools Wills
7f8b1bd062
bluetooth configuration improvements
...
* deal with RequestConfirmation responses - ignore errors from the python script and just check connection as it seems to pair and connect despite reporting problems. may help #1611
2016-08-05 00:46:23 +01:00
Jools Wills
65cea63be1
runcommand - /run/shm > /dev/shm
2016-08-04 20:21:59 +01:00
Jools Wills
7a66005296
runcommand - save information about what is being launched
...
* save info to /dev/shm/runcommand.info
* one line per variable - system, emulator, rom and full commandline
2016-08-04 20:18:12 +01:00
Jools Wills
89856227b3
runcommand - change log location to /dev/shm/runcommand.log (tmpfs)
2016-08-04 20:17:04 +01:00
Jools Wills
0c39c7438b
runcommand - pass parameters "$system" "$emulator" "$rom" "$command" to onstart/oneend scripts
2016-08-04 20:02:25 +01:00
Jools Wills
8522687c08
runcommand - don't rely on the +Start scripts to be executable (in the case they are moved onto fat32 etc). Launch via bash directly
2016-08-04 14:03:40 +01:00
Jools Wills
ad5291ec2a
pifba - remove some wrong code that was left in input configuration
2016-08-03 03:58:39 +01:00
Jools Wills
dcf288be87
scraper - left over debug
2016-08-03 01:02:44 +01:00
Jools Wills
aae2158f7a
scraper - defaults were wrong on first run
2016-08-03 01:00:18 +01:00
Jools Wills
75971f85aa
retropiemenu - another fix for #1599
2016-08-01 01:18:50 +01:00
Jools Wills
74aad17d4d
emulationstation - less verbose when copying inputscripts
2016-08-01 01:02:02 +01:00
Jools Wills
e8649864db
retropie-menu - when launching retropie-setup from menu - use exec so we don't return to an older running script after (which break things) - should fix #1599
2016-08-01 00:49:57 +01:00
Jools Wills
d29e446d94
runcommand - always update the installed runcommand when updating retropie-setup
2016-07-30 19:25:04 +01:00
Jools Wills
dda6870b0a
emulationstation - always update the input confoiguration scripts when updating retropie-setup
2016-07-30 19:24:34 +01:00
Jools Wills
71fe2c9062
runcommand - don't try and set refresh rate if tvservice returns 00Hz (as with gert VGA 666)
2016-07-30 19:23:34 +01:00
Jools Wills
4cf874513c
emulationstation - prompt before resetting es_input.cfg
2016-07-29 20:18:38 +01:00
Jools Wills
fc578424b0
emulationstation - gui for switching the swap a/b buttons config
2016-07-29 20:15:38 +01:00
Jools Wills
c227b0ee3b
configedit - devs array is unused
2016-07-27 16:15:29 +01:00
Jools Wills
614f8c5112
configedit - put devs arary in joystick check
2016-07-27 16:11:36 +01:00
Jools Wills
8c553ade11
configedit - only allow section of /dev/input/jsX devices with "ID_INPUT_JOYSTICK=1" set
2016-07-27 16:09:23 +01:00
meleu
4cea2d55bd
user can define __joy2key_dev
...
Same logic as in `helpers.sh`.
Since the `runcommand-onstart.sh` was implemented, the user can define another joystick device to use with joy2key.
2016-07-27 11:16:25 -03:00
Jools Wills
b4e24b0786
runcommand - remove old compatibility code
2016-07-27 13:50:19 +01:00
Jools Wills
2c928d2cfa
runcommand - added support for running $configdir/all/runcommand-onstart.sh / runcommand-onend.sh when launching
2016-07-27 13:46:03 +01:00
Jools Wills
47b98de4e8
configedit - remove unused code
2016-07-27 11:29:05 +01:00
Jools Wills
6197a672a0
configedit - allow configuration of joypad order
2016-07-26 18:57:20 +01:00
Jools Wills
be4e42e38b
move joy2key starting/stopping to functions
2016-07-21 01:23:01 +01:00
Jools Wills
14daf4d476
runcommand - don't try and get framebuffer details if running from X
2016-07-21 01:13:37 +01:00
Jools Wills
8528c5ac66
xboxdrv - don't force removal of packaged xboxdrv
2016-07-21 00:20:19 +01:00
Jools Wills
7696e2586e
raspbiantools - allow modification of /etc/X11/Xwrapper.config so LXDE can be launched from ES
2016-07-19 03:33:53 +01:00
Jools Wills
f63ca15caa
ini format for dispmanx config
2016-07-19 01:43:50 +01:00
Jools Wills
e9c5357948
standardise some of our ini file format / delimiter (will still read old values - and is less fussy this way)
2016-07-19 01:03:49 +01:00
Jools Wills
87bc57beae
scraper - remember menu position
2016-07-19 00:09:21 +01:00
Jools Wills
2f31177fc3
scraper - save settings to $configdir/all/scraper.cfg
2016-07-19 00:08:08 +01:00
Jools Wills
14bd0e50cd
scraper - add support for using the rom folder for gamelist & images
2016-07-18 23:49:52 +01:00
Jools Wills
45ebec12ee
8bitdo mapping improvements
...
* add autoconf.cfg parameter 8bitdo_hack (default 1) to decide whether to add the offset to the inputs for retroarch - which is required on the older firmware
* make sure autoconf.cfg is owned by $user - it would be created as root previously
* add setAutoConf function
* cleanup retroarch config generation code
2016-07-16 16:42:26 +01:00
Jools Wills
d68f880c3d
reverse return code of getAutoConf
2016-07-16 15:49:31 +01:00
Jools Wills
9675049e12
inputconfig - module skipping
...
* support a check_module function to skip the module if it returns 1
* skip pifba config generation if pifba is not installed (relies on existing config)
2016-07-15 00:08:45 +01:00
Jools Wills
df9ab33230
bashwelcometweak - adjust bottom of ascii fixes #1572
2016-07-14 16:28:51 +01:00
Jools Wills
3f75b5df57
bashwelcometweak - local vars
2016-07-13 18:23:58 +01:00
Jools Wills
83f41452c1
bashwelcometweak - cosmetic
2016-07-13 18:20:50 +01:00
Jools Wills
8f57563336
bashwelcometweak update
...
* new logo
* code rework / cleanup
2016-07-13 18:18:22 +01:00
Ing. Jan Kaláb
5102aa2f3a
More universal disable blanker ( #1571 )
2016-07-13 10:39:40 +01:00